Description
The Tuff Country 27852 Rear U-bolt Kit is a zinc-plated, corrosion-resistant retrofit designed for lifted trucks and SUVs that use 2" to 4" lift blocks. It includes all four U-bolts plus the necessary nuts and washers to secure your rear axle reliably.
- Contents: Includes four U-bolts along with nuts and washers for a complete installation.
- Finish: Zinc-plated steel provides corrosion resistance for long-lasting performance in all weather conditions.
- Dimensions: Bolt diameter 9/16"; inner diameter 3.5"; length 10.5"; bend type is round.
- Compatibility: Designed for use with 2"–4" lift blocks; fits rear axle applications on lifted setups.
- Vehicle fitment notes: Suitable for 1973–1987 GMC Suburban K2500 4WD and 1973–1987 GMC Truck 4WD configurations.
These U-bolts are specifically engineered to replace worn factory hardware on lifted suspensions, helping maintain secure block mounting and axle alignment. The durable zinc finish protects against rust, while the included nuts and washers simplify installation and ensure a clean, secure fit. Ideal for restoring reliability in older GMC rear suspensions or any compatible 9/16" U-bolt, 3.5" inside diameter, 10.5" long setup connected to 2"–4" lift blocks.
